Foreword by Sally Tallant. Text by David Antin, et al.
Published for the eighth Liverpool Biennial, A Needle Walks into a Haystack reflects on notions of intimacy, delinquency and inefficiency though the work of critics, philosophers and writers such as David Antin, Keren Cytter, Eileen Myles, Lisa Robertson, Matthew Stadler, Edward Said and George Szirtes. It includes drawings by Abraham Cruzvillegas.
